Summary
Recounts the problems faced by three returning veterans of WWII as they attempt to pick up the threads of their lives. Captain Derry is returning to a loveless marriage, Sergeant Stephenson is a stranger to a family that's grown up without him, and sailor Parrish is tormented by the loss of his hands
Awards note
Academy Awards (1947): Honorary award (Russell), Best actor (March), Best director, Best film editing, Best music, Best picture, Best supporting actor (Russell), Best writing, screenplay.
